Amanda Darling

Amanda earned her PhD in Civil Engineering (Environmental and Water Resources Engineering Program) at Virginia Tech in 2024. Amanda also completed a Masters of Science in Environmental Engineering in 2020, and a Masters of Public Health in 2023. Her PhD research focused on wastewater-based surveillance in rural areas of Central Appalachia, dissertation title: “Advancing Rural Public Health: From Drinking Water Quality and Health Outcome Meta-analyses to Wastewater-based Pathogen Monitoring”. Prior to Virginia Tech she attended the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ign, graduating with a Bachelor’s degree in Civil & Environmental Engineering. In her free time, Amanda enjoys traveling and volunteering. Amanda is currently an ORISE Fellow with the US EPA in Washington DC. [last updated 2025-03]
